What if the path to rebuilding a life after addiction starts with seeing potential where others see limitations? In this powerful TEDx talk, a personal experience leads to a deeper exploration of the barriers people face during recovery and the overlooked strengths that can emerge from their journeys. Through stories of resilience, reinvention, and entrepreneurship, this talk challenges us to rethink how we support those in recovery and imagine new pathways toward purpose and opportunity. David Nelson is the Executive Director of FoundersForge (a nonprofit entrepreneur center located in Johnson City) and East Tennessee State University faculty member in the Entrepreneurship Program. David's passion is empowering underdog entrepreneurs throughout the Appalachian Highlands, and through impactful regional initiatives — from startup bootcamps to pitch competitions — he helps make entrepreneurship more accessible, inclusive, and sustainable throughout rural and emerging markets. A seasoned entrepreneur himself, David has launched multiple tech ventures across sectors including healthcare, software, and agency services, bringing real-world startup experience to his work. Under his guidance, FoundersForge provides free mentorship, coaching, networking opportunities, and programming that connects founders with critical resources, investors, and community partners — all designed to stimulate economic growth and innovation across Northeast Tennessee and beyond.
